Transaction 3e0784ffbc135d1ba107f1bc20f751087512affb3e15b40cb7db858fedf19cdb
1 Input
1 Outputs
- 3e0784ffbc135d1ba107f1bc20f751087512affb3e15b40cb7db858fedf19cdb:0
value 1469421
address 1K1Xk6S2rs4bpiVdbPmrK228uLQojCSSyY